1 definition found From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Imbrangle \Im*bran"gle\, v. t. To entangle as in a cobweb; to mix confusedly. [R.] --Hudibras. [1913 Webster] Physiology imbrangled with an inapplicable logic. --Coleridge. [1913 Webster]
